Transaction 6606065d8021aa67efd44d820d7d1693d1d356b4166d374763d11ec58e443876
1 Input
1 Output
-
6606065d8021aa67efd44d820d7d1693d1d356b4166d374763d11ec58e443876:0
- value
- 31424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42365b11b98c78afa63c0ee830089247b0b0bbb7 OP_EQUAL
- address
- 37j7dubC12oh6tC1CZc3ELuvuM8CrF1CuP